Lucille Carter Everhart

October 13, 1925 — May 11, 2019

Mamie Lucille Carter Everhart, 93, of Easter Road, Lexington, died Saturday, May 11 at Abbotts Creek Center in Lexington.    A graveside service will be held at  11 am Tuesday, May 14 at Forest Hill Memorial Park, by the Revs. Gary Myers and Barry Queen.        The family will receive friends from 6-8pm Monday at Davidson Funeral Home-Hickory Tree Chapel and other times at the home of her daughter, Joyce Myers on Hunter Road, Lexington.   Mrs. Everhart was born October 13, 1925 in Davidson County to Lester Lee Carter, Sr. and Zula Everhart Carter.  She retired from Edgewood Apparel and was a member of Ebenezer United Methodist Church.  Her husband, Thomas Wood Everhart; her son, Thomas Allen Everhart; her brothers, Lester Carter, Jr. and Alvin Thomason; her sisters, Pearlie Mae Lee and Maxine Stokes; and her great grandson, Benjamin Walker, preceded her in death.    She is survived by her daughters, Karen Walker (Jerry) of Clemmons and Joyce Myers (Gary) of Midway; her daughter in law, Libby Everhart of Midway; her sister in law, Mae Bailey; her grandchildren, Leigh Hyatt, Dr. Robert Walker, Jason Everhart, Misty Norris, Beth Hair, and Josh Myers; 13 great grandchildren, 3 great great-grandchildren, and several nieces and nephews.    In lieu of flowers, memorials may be made to Ebenezer United Methodist Church, 1087 Leonard Rd, Lexington NC 27295 or to Hospice of the Piedmont, 1801 Westchester Road, High Point NC 27262.
